參考:
KLog
logger
Android開發(fā)Log最佳實(shí)踐-一個簡單、漂亮、功能強(qiáng)大的Android日志程序:logger
AndroidStudio -開源項(xiàng)目日志輸入工具==Logger
Android Logger 日志框架實(shí)現(xiàn)
前言:網(wǎng)上也有很多l(xiāng)ogger使用的介紹文章,但查閱了最新github的出處,發(fā)現(xiàn)人家已經(jīng)更新到2.1.1的版本,而網(wǎng)上大多基本停留在1.1左右的版本,這里介紹一下接入使用的過程:
下面介紹下logger使用:出處
引入:
compile 'com.orhanobut:logger:2.1.1'
初始化:(不執(zhí)行l(wèi)og不打?。?/p>
Logger.addLogAdapter(new AndroidLogAdapter());//logcat日志面板輸出
Logger.addLogAdapter(new DiskLogAdapter());//支持本地log日志輸出,可用office軟件打開查閱
提供的方法:不同方法打印的顏色不同
Logger.d("debug");
Logger.e("error");
Logger.w("warning");
Logger.v("verbose");
Logger.i("information");
Logger.wtf("wtf!!!!");
支持占位符寫法:
Logger.d("hello %s", "world");
支持集合對象直接打印:
Logger.d(MAP);
Logger.d(SET);
Logger.d(LIST);
Logger.d(ARRAY);
支持json、xml格式打印
Logger.json(JSON_CONTENT);
Logger.xml(XML_CONTENT);